>>730821
There was Wonder Project J on the SNES and it's sequel J2 on the N64. They were a lot like Pac-Man 2 but with some RPG stat mechanics (in J1 at least, J2 dropped them) and you could teach the protagonist to always act a certain way with objects.

There was also Lifeline on the PS2 where you gave voice commands to the protagonist using a microphone.

I'm about 50/50 on this game. I though it was bizarrely entertaining as a kid, and I remember screwing around with my mom and dad, trying to figure out just what the fuck we had to do to get more stuff. I think we together 100%'d the game too.

And yet, it's also incredibly frustrating and is very much like an old adventure game, in that you have to find the exact way to do things because there are so many things out there that fuck you up in horrible ways. In the end, the controls are pretty bad, and yet that was probably the point.

And yet again, I can't help but admire what they were trying to go for. It was definitely innovative in its own little way - and it said it right on the box - "an interactive cartoon". So it wasn't supposed to be actually responsive and the like, and it was more about stumbling around from awkward situation to awkward situation, laughing at Pac-Man's misfortune until you make it to the end.
